Building raising services involve elevating existing structures to improve their foundation stability or to accommodate changing land conditions. This process typically includes lifting a building off its current foundation, often using hydraulic jacks or other specialized equipment, and then placing it on a new, more secure foundation or piers. The goal is to ensure the building remains structurally sound and functional, especially in areas prone to flooding, water damage, or land subsidence. Building raising is a precise operation that requires careful planning and execution to prevent damage and ensure compliance with local building codes.
This service addresses several common problems faced by property owners. Flood-prone areas often see buildings at risk of water intrusion, which can lead to significant damage and costly repairs. Raising a building can mitigate these risks by elevating the structure above flood levels. Additionally, properties situated on unstable or shifting land may experience foundation issues over time, leading to structural instability or uneven floors. Building raising provides a solution by repositioning the structure on a more stable foundation, helping to preserve the property's value and usability.
Typically, building raising services are used for residential homes, especially those located in flood zones or areas with changing land conditions. Commercial properties, such as small businesses or community buildings, may also utilize this service to protect assets from water damage or land movement. In some cases, historic or vintage structures are raised to preserve their integrity while adapting to new environmental challenges. The process can be applied to various property types, provided they are constructed in a manner that allows for safe and effective lifting and re-support.

The overview below groups typical Building Raising proj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Osceola,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Costs - Building raising typically involves foundation modifications, costing between $3,000 and $10,000 depending on the size and complexity of the structure. For example, a small home may require around $4,500, while larger buildings could approach $9,500.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for building raising services can range from $2,000 to $8,000. The total depends on the project's scope, with more extensive work requiring additional hours and skilled labor.
Permitting and Inspection - Permit fees and inspection costs generally range from $200 to $1,500. These fees vary based on local regulations and the project's location within Osceola, WI and surrounding areas.
Additional Services - Extra services such as site preparation or structural reinforcement may add $1,000 to $4,000 to the total cost. These costs depend on specific site conditions and the extent of work need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
